I have a 89 f350, 351w with a zf-42 and I would like to add some power to it. This truck is only to be used to pull a 32' 5th wheel travel trailer
The shorty headers I can extend with my mig.
If these parts could be of value what should I be looking for. EG what kind of heads should they be in order for me to use. The whole deal is $200 but I have to take everything. If I'm not building a hotrod is this MAF sufficient, would the cam help or am I tossing it. I know I'll have to get a set of roller liftes to use it but can I use a set of low milleage lifters.
I know I exeeded my 1 question per thread limit but I can't count. Thank you for your advice, I'm not in love with these parts and I don't mind passing on them as theres other fish in the sea.
The only thing worth anything to you is the cam IMO, it's a healthy upgrade from what you have now but it's not worth $200 and you need fairly expensive roller lifters and a new set of pushrods to use it. The heads and injectors are the same as what's on your 5.8 now and the MAC headers would be an upgrade if the stock Y pipe and cat are replaced with something else when they are installed, otherwise it's a lot of work for no gain.
